What is the difference between Relationship selling and traditional selling?
Relationship selling is the practice of building, maintaining, and enhancing interactions with customers to develop long-term satisfaction through mutually beneficial partnerships. Traditional selling, on the other hand, is transaction focused.

What is traditional personal selling?
Definition: Personal selling is also known as face-to-face selling in which one person who is the salesman tries to convince the customer in buying a product. It is a promotional method by which the salesperson uses his or her skills and abilities in an attempt to make a sale.

What is transaction focused traditional selling?
The main difference between these two is that transaction focused is a one and done type sale where no relationship is necessary by either the buyer or the seller. While a trust-based type of selling makes a relationship because in the future both the buyer and seller will need each other for some purpose.
What are the traditional approaches of marketing?
Traditional marketing relies on offline strategies, including direct sales, direct mail (postcards, brochures, letters, fliers), tradeshows, print advertising (magazines, newspapers, coupon books, billboards), referral (also known as word-of-mouth marketing), radio, and television.
What is an example of transactional selling?
Example of transactional marketing
a shopping channel on TV advertising a BOGO offer for a new product and provides a phone number or website to buy the product in that moment; and. a convenience store selling one brand of a product, but also displaying another brand on a promotional display next to it at a lower price
